VW Touareg

CRCA 3.0L TDI V6 245 hp Automatic All-wheel drive SUV 2010–2018
βœ– Stay Away!
Engine CRCA βœ– Stay Away! 7,670–43,100 $

Solid V6 common-rail diesel with good refinement, but known timing chain weakness and tendency to EGR fouling. Plastic coolant circuit components age and can lead to head gasket failure β€” always take coolant loss seriously immediately.

Engine Weaknesses 5

!! Timing Chain Rattling and Stretch

The 3.0 V6 TDI tends to chain stretch with metallic rattling from cold start. Noticeable particularly between 80,000 and 160,000 km. Chain tensioner responds positively to frequent oil changes with better oil.

Symptoms: Metallic rattling from the engine bay on cold start, especially at 1,800–2,100 rpm

1,500–4,000 $ from 120,000 km
!! EGR Cooler Plastic Connector Breaks

A plastic connector between the EGR cooler and coolant shut-off valve breaks over time. Minimal coolant loss is often ignored β€” until the head gasket burns through and water enters the combustion chamber.

Symptoms: Slight coolant loss without visible leak, fluctuating coolant temperature, occasional white exhaust plume

20–3,000 $ from 180,000 km
!! Common-Rail Injector Wear

Faulty injectors cause rough running, increased consumption and smoke. Individual injectors cost 300–600 € plus labour; total failure of all six exceeds 3,000 €.

Symptoms: Rough engine, increased consumption, smoking, hard knocking, quantity corrections on individual cylinders

400–3,000 $ from 150,000 km
!! Plastic EGR Cooler Connector Leaking β€” Engine Damage

A plastic part costing 20–30 € between the EGR cooler and the coolant shut-off valve breaks and causes massive coolant loss. Leads to head gasket failure.

Symptoms: Coolant loss without visible leak, temperature spikes to 130Β°C, engine not running on all cylinders, white smoke

800–5,000 $ from 150,000 km
!! EGR Valve Soot Fouling

The EGR valve clogs with oil and soot on short trips. Power loss and rough idle result. Cleaning helps temporarily; with heavy fouling replacement is necessary.

Symptoms: Fluctuating idle speed, power deficit in the lower rpm range, sluggish throttle response

300–800 $ from 100,000 km

Vehicle Weaknesses 15

!! Suspension Air suspension: compressor relay and condensate damage

Same system weakness as the predecessor: the 40A relay seizes after 3–4 years; condensate ice blocks the compressor in winter. Compressor overheating can be dangerous. Compressor replacement: 400–1,500 €.

400–2,000 $ from 100,000 km
!! Electronics CAN bus failure: multiple systems fail simultaneously

CAN bus communication faults cause the simultaneous failure of multiple systems (reversing camera, ACC, towing module, start-stop). Often caused by a faulty trailer control unit J345 or insufficient battery voltage.

200–2,000 $ from 80,000 km
!! Gearbox Transfer case bearing damage at front axle output

On the Touareg 7P, the ball bearing at the front axle output of the transfer case wears due to insufficient lubrication in the ZF transfer case. Repair requires approx. 10 hours of workshop time.

800–2,900 $ from 150,000 km
!! Brakes Brake discs: high wear due to vehicle weight

Brake discs wear out prematurely on the heavy Touareg 7P, sometimes after just 30,000–40,000 km. Full brake service (front and rear axle) costs approx. 2,800 €. The electric parking brake requires software tools for pad changes.

800–2,800 $ from 40,000 km
!! Electronics Electric parking brake: malfunctions

Electric parking brake fails to release or shows fault messages. The cause is defective actuator switches or actuator motors. Repair: 300–800 €. Software tools are essential for pad changes.

300–800 $ from 80,000 km
!! Body Panoramic roof: leaks and water ingress

Seals between the longitudinal and transverse drain channels of the panoramic roof fail, especially on 2015 model year vehicles. Water penetrates and rusts internal metal carriers. Frame replacement can cost up to €1,600.

200–1,600 $
!! Electronics ACC and Front Assist: spontaneous failure

Adaptive cruise control and Front Assist regularly drop out and show 'unavailable'. Often caused by a dirty or misaligned radar sensor. Radar sensor replacement costs over 2,000 €.

500–2,500 $
!! Rust Door flange corrosion on door edges

Rust forms in the door flanges and at door inner edges, particularly on the tailgate. Paint undermining creates visible blisters. Less common than on the predecessor, but documented on older 7P models.

300–2,000 $ from 120,000 km
!! Gearbox Automatic gearbox: oil loss and shift juddering

The automatic gearbox shows irregular shift behaviour and oil loss at higher mileages. Regular gearbox oil changes (every 60,000 km) are important. Gearbox overhaul: 3,000–6,000 €.

200–6,000 $ from 150,000 km
!! Body Propshaft centre bearing defective

The rubber bearing in the rear propshaft ages and cracks as the rubber becomes brittle through weathering. VW only supplies the complete propshaft β€” individual centre bearing replacement is not factory-supported.

350–1,400 $ from 130,000 km
!! Body Water ingress at the rear / boot area

On the Touareg 7P, the water drain hose in the rear wheel arch detaches from its holder. Water runs directly into the spare wheel well instead of outside. The hose can be permanently secured with cable ties.

50–300 $
! Interior Panoramic roof: creaking and rattling noises

The panoramic glass roof creaks especially on the motorway due to play in the sliding rails. Acid-free synthetic grease on the rails usually resolves the problem.

0–200 $
! Interior Leather seats: premature wear on driver's side

Vienna leather seats show wear-through on the driver's seat surface after approx. 2–3 years. Leather quality is considered a weak point, although the interior overall is regarded as high quality.

200–1,500 $
! HVAC Rear blower motor (4-zone AC) failure

On the Touareg 7P with 4-zone climate control, the blower motor in the boot (left side) fails. Cause is worn carbon brushes or a defective PWM control unit. The installation position makes repair labour-intensive.

150–500 $ from 120,000 km
! Electronics Electric tailgate won't open

On the Touareg 7P with electric tailgate, the drive motor fails. The tailgate doesn't respond to the switch, key, or interior button. Failing gas struts increase the load on the motor further.

200–800 $ from 100,000 km
